تعلم البرمجة بلغة بايثون واستخدامها لحل المشكلات العلمية والاجتماعية. سيتناول هذا المساق أساسيات الدوال والمتغيرات لبناء برامج فعالة وقابلة لإعادة الاستخدام. ستكتسب مهارات التحكم في تدفق البرامج من خلال الشروط والحلقات التكرارية، بالإضافة إلى تطبيق مبادئ البرمجة الدفاعية ومعالجة الأخطاء لضمان استقرار البرامج. ستتعلم كيفية استخدام المكتبات الخارجية لإعادة استخدام الكود وتسهيل تطوير البرامج، وكتابة اختبارات الوحدة للتحقق من صحة الكود. كما ستتعرف على كيفية التعامل مع الملفات وتحليل البيانات باستخدام التعبيرات النمطية (Regex) وتصميم برامج كائنية التوجه (OOP) لتنظيم الكود وتطوير مشاريع متقدمة.
محتوى الدورة
المحتوى
-
00:00
-
00:00
-
00:00
-
00:00
-
00:00
-
00:00
-
00:00
-
00:00
-
00:00
-
00:00
-
Final Exam – CS50P: برمجة بايثون للمبتدئين

















































































